79. To ask the Minister for Public Expenditure and Reform the bodies under the aegis of his Department; and the composition of their respective board memberships, disaggregated by appointments through the Public Appointments Service or inisterial appointments in tabular form. [42484/20]
Michael McGrath (Cork South Central,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source
As set out in tabular format below, two Statutory Offices under the aegis of the Department of Public Expenditure and Reform have advisory boards. Details regarding the composition, membership and appointment of these boards is set out in the legislation which established both bodies.
The Department also provides grant funding to the Economic and Social Research Institute (ESRI) and the Institute of Public Administration (IPA). Neither organisation is a State Body, however both organisations adhere to the provisions of the Code of Practice for the Governance of State Bodies.
Organisation | Total Board Members | Appointed by the Minister following a PAS Selection Process |
---|---|---|
National Shared Services Office | 9 (including the CEO as an ex-officio member) | 2 |
Public Appointments Service | 9 (including the CEO as an ex-officio member) | 3 |
Office of Public Works | N/A | |
State Laboratory | N/A | |
Office of the Ombudsman (including the Office of the Information Commissioner, the Office of the Commissioner for Environmental Information, the Standards in Public Office Commission and the Commission for Public Service Appointments) | N/A | |
Office of the Regulator of the National Lottery | N/A | |
Special EU Programmes Body | N/A |
Grant Funded Organisations
Organisation | Total Board Members | Appointed by Minister following PAS Selection Process |
---|---|---|
Institute of Public Administration | 14 | 0* *The IPA has a 14 member representative Board, and no members are appointed by the Minister. As set out in the Articles of Association governing the Institute, nominations are sought from different bodies and sectors of the public service every two years). |
